Why does I-180 in IL exist?

0

I-180 serves the town of Hennepin, population 707 (2000 census). It was built to serve LTV steel, a major defense contractor. In the future it may be extended south to Peoria, signed either as I-180 or IL-29 ( http://www.dot.il.gov/il29/default.aspx ), but it currently has almost no traffic.
